    Curcuma sp. is generally used for medicine, starch sources, preservatives, dyes and cosmetics. The use of Curcuma spp. for medical has increased because there have been many studies related to its active ingredients, such as flavonoids, essential oils, tannins, quinones, and terpenoids, as well as pharmacological activities, including wound healing, antioxidants, antifungal, anticancer, gastroprotective, and hepatoprotective. Curcuma purpurascens Blume is a species of Curcuma from family Zingiberaceae and used for traditional medicine. This article focuses on reviewing the literatures on C. purpurascens and discussing its morphology, phytochemical content, and pharmacological aspects. The method used to review this article was by exploring several databases such as Scopus, Pub Med, and Google Scholar to identify and download original articles and research journals related to the morphology, phytochemical content, and biological activity of Curcuma purpurascens Blume. The result of this review will later provide information about the uses and presence of Curcuma purpurascens Blume which is still rarely studied so further study related to its pharmacological activity tests and active compound as natural medicines can be explored

Background: Temu mangga (Curcuma mangga) and kunir putih (Curcuma zedoaria) rhizomes have been utilized by people to treat cancer lately although clinically their activity has not been tested. Objectives: This study is aimed to prove their activity as anticancer on 7 major human cancers cell lines (in vitro), and to evaluate whether these two rhizomes are potential for new anticancer drug. Methods: The two rhizomes were separately extracted with chloroform followed by methanol to give chloroform extracts of C. mangga (CmCh) and C. zedoaria (CzCh)and methanol extracts of C. mangga (CmMe) and C. zedoaria (CzMe) respectively. These extracts were tested their cytotoxic effect on 7 major human cancer cell lines using SRB method (in vitro). Doxorubicin and cisplatin were used as positive controls, and their cytotoxic effects were measured by comparing their ID50 with that of the positive controls. Results: Those four extracts (CmCh, CzCh, CmMe and CzMe) practically did not perform cytotoxic effect on those human cancer cell lines, because the extract\u27s ID50 was far higher than the positive controls on those human, cancers cell lines Conclusion: The C. mangga and C. zedoaria rhizomes did not active as anticancer and they were not pOtential as the source of a new anticancer drug.     Puji Astuti, Sylvia Utami Tunjung Pratiwi, Triana Hertiani, Gemini Alam, Akbar Tahir, Subagus Wahyuono - Marine Sponge Jaspis sp, A Potential Bioactive Natural Source against Infectious diseases Background: The high incidence of microbial infection and the emergence of drug resistant and multidrugresistant microbes as well as the lack of any current chemotherapy augmented the necessity to search for new and better antimicrobial drug. Marine invertebrates are known as rich sources of compounds with unique chemical structures and pronounced chemical and biological activities, which suggests potential value as lead structures for the development of new pharmaceuticals. Objective: This study aims to screen potential antiinfective of sponges extracts collected from Barrang Lompo island and report on their antibacterial and antifungal properties. Methods: Testing for anti-infective agents was conducted using dilution method. Nutrient Agar was used as the testing media and nutrient broth for the inoculation of microorganisms. Staphylococcus aureus, Escherichia coil and Salmonella thypi were used as the testing bacteria and Candida albicans for the testing fungi. Chloramphenicol was used as positive control for antibacterial testing and ketocozaole for antifungal testing. Results: From the 11 acetone extracts tested, BL-02, BL-09, BL-10 and BL-12 was found to inhibit the growth of microorganisms and the extract of BL-10 was found to be the most active. Bioautography results suggest that the polar fractions were responsible for the growth inhibition. Conclusion: the polar fraction of acetone extract of BL-10 was considered to be potential compounds for further characterization as anti infective agents. Kata kunci : Amsonia grandiflora, Apocynaceae, lupeol, asetil lupeol dan lupeil Ahidroksioktadekanoate ABSTRACT A phytochemical investigation on the non-polar fraction of Amsonia grandiflora has been done. A triterpene compound of lupane skeleton and its derivatives were isolated. These compounds were identified as lupeol, acetyl lupeol and lupeol /3-hydroxyoctadecanoate based on their chemical and physical data (ir, ms, nmr), and direct comparison with authentic lupeol. ABSTRACT An indigenous desert plant, Amsonia grandiflora, has a high carbohydrate content and an animal feed nutritive value in-vitro similar to alfalfahowever, this plant is not grazed in the wild. Two triterpene acids were isolated from the dichloromethane extract of A. grandiflora that was insoluble in n-hexane. Based on their infrared, mass and nuclear magnetic resonance spectra as well as their melting points and optical rotations, the two acids were suspected to be betulinic acid and oleanolic acid. Direct comparison of these two acids with authentic betulinic and oleanolic acid, these acids were confirmed as betulinic acid and oleanolic acid. The high concentrations of oleanolic acid and betulinic acid might impart a sour taste to the plant. This could possibly be the reason that animals in the wild do not grazed this plant.
